Rendering Plant 3D Components in Standard AutoCAD

We have created ortho drawings in Plant 3D with a manually created viewport that references an iso view of our model rendered as SHADED. It displays and plots fine. However, when we bring this same ortho drawing up in standard AutoCAD (2011) some of the components in the rendered iso view display as wire frame and will not display as SHADED like the rest of the components.

Why is this and how can we get AutoCAD to render all Plant 3D components as SHADED?

Does the machine with the AutoCAD have the Object Enablers installed? If you don't want to use the live model, do a EXPORTTOAUTOCAD on the original model, save it as another one and then use that?

Download the Object Enablers for Plant here: http://usa.autodesk.com/adsk/servlet/ps/dl/item?siteID=123112&id=17658426&linkID=9240618

 

If that doesn't fix it, then I'm not sure. Like I said, doing the export means you have two copies of the model, a live Plant3D version, and a DWG snapshot at the time of the export.

 

Try the Object Enablers first, see how you go with that.
